The Olympic Region of the Washington State Department of Natural Resources (DNR) is looking for a Fiscal Analyst 1 to help in our busy fiscal department located in Forks, WA. The Fiscal Analyst 1 will assist with processing region payments to our vendors, collect, organize, and enter into AssetWorks the monthly equipment reports (MERs), and assist with payroll, bank deposits, and cash applications.Responsibilities:
